Meat Pies or Meat Fataya Recipe

Ingredients:

1½ lbs. ground round beef
1 large onion (chopped)
1 c. pecans (toasted)
¼ tsp. cinnamon
1 c. plain yogurt
1 can Hungry Jack flakey biscuits (not butter biscuits)

Directions:

Sauté onion and brown beef in skillet. Add toasted nuts and yogurt. Mix well.

Separate each biscuit into two pieces, roll each piece into a circle. Add 1 heaping tablespoon of meat mixture to each rolled circle. Pinch and fold into a crescent triangle shape.

Bake at 400º degrees until browned.
